Detailed Description

Model a 3-D surface.

Given a set of (x,y,z) triplets, this class will model the surface that best fits the points. The equation to be modelled is:

\[ z = a + b*x + c*y + d*x^2 + e*x*y + f*y^2 \]

int Isis::SurfaceModel::MinMax ( double &  x,
double &  y 
)

After invoking Solve, a coordinate (x,y) at a local minimum (or maximum) of the surface model can be computed using this method.

Returns:
A zero if successful, otherwise, the surface is a plane and has no min/max
